Report No.:DDT-RE25090403-1E02 TRF:RT-4-E-005Page 51 of 95 (2) At frequencies below 30 MHz, measurement may be performed at a distance closer than that specified, and the limit at closer measurement distance can be extrapolated by below formula: Limit 3m (dBuV/m)= Limit 30m (dBuV/m) + 40Log(30m/3m) (3) Limit for this EUT The emissions appearing within 15.205 restricted frequency bands shall not exceed the limits shown in 15.209, and the emissions appearing within RSS-Gen section 8.10 Restricted frequency bands shall not exceed the limits shown in RSS-Gen section 8.9, all the other emissions shall be at least 20 dB below the fundamental emissions or comply with 15.209 limits and RSS-Gen section 8.9 limits. 12.4. Assistant equipment used for test Assistant equipment ManufacturerModel numberDescriptionother ///// 12.5. Test procedure (1) EUT was placed on a non-metallic table, 80 cm above the ground plane inside a semi-anechoic chamber for below 1G and 150 cm above the ground plane inside a fully-anechoic chamber for above 1G. (2) Test antenna was located 3 m from the EUT on an adjustable mast, and the antenna used as below table. Test frequency rangeTest antenna usedTest antenna distance 9 kHz - 30 MHzActive Loop antenna3 m 30 MHz - 1 GHzTrilog Broadband Antenna3 m 1 GHz - 18 GHzDouble Ridged Horn Antenna(1 GHz-18 GHz)3 m 18 GHz - 40 GHzHorn Antenna(18 GHz-40 GHz)1 m According ANSI C63.10:2013 clause 6.4.6 and 6.5.3, for measurements below 30 MHz, Antenna was located 3 m from EUT, the loop antenna was positioned in three antenna orientations (parallel, perpendicular, and round-parallel), for each measurement antenna alignment, the EUT shall be rotated through 0°to 360°on a turntable, and the lowest height of the magnetic antenna shall be 1 m above the ground. For measurement above 30MHz, the trilog Broadband Antenna or Horn Antenna was located 3m from EUT, Measurements were made with the antenna positioned in both the horizontal and vertical planes of Polarization, and the measurement antenna was varied from 1 m to 4 m. in height above the reference ground plane to obtain the maximum signal strength. (3) Below pre-scan procedure was first performed in order to find prominent frequency spectrum radiated emissions from 9 kHz to 25 GHz: (a) Scanning the peak frequency spectrum with the antenna specified in step (3), and the EUT was rotated 360 degree, the antenna height was varied from 1 m to 4 m (Except loop antenna, it’s fixed 1 m above ground.) (b) Change work frequency or channel of device if practicable. Guangdong Dongdian Testing Service Co., Ltd. Report No.:DDT-RE25090403-1E02 TRF:RT-4-E-005Page 52 of 95 (c) Change modulation type of device if practicable. (d) Change power supply range from 85% to 115% of the rated supply voltage (e) Rotated EUT though three orthogonal axes to determine the attitude of EUT arrangement produces highest emissions. Spectrum frequency from 9 kHz to 25 GHz (tenth harmonic of fundamental frequency) was investigated, and no any obvious emission were detected from 18 GHz to 25 GHz, so below final test was performed with frequency range from 9 kHz to 18 GHz. (4) For final emissions measurements at each frequency of interest, the EUT was rotated and the antenna height was varied between 1 m and 4 m in order to maximize the emission. Measurements in both horizontal and vertical polarities were made and the data was recorded.
